Airwerks #177287, 63/68 turbo with 3rd gen compressor cover. Has 0.91 divided T4 exhaust housing (marmon flange), and an upgraded 11-blade wheel I got from Smokem years back. Shaft play is acceptable. Note - there is noticeable oil residue on the bottom of the compressor housing and backing plate. Truck has not ran since 2015, however I had put a few thousand miles on it after noticing this, with no ill effect. During that time I pulled the compressor housing a few times and checked it and the charge pipe between turbo and intercooler, and other than a black film on the compressor backing plate there was no other oil residue to be found in the intake tract.

Turbo will come with original compressor wheel and 0.88 T4 open exhaust housing if purchaser wishes.

Wastegate is a 50mm ED unit, with the T4 1" spacer and welded pipe stub. I added a divider in the stub that separates the volutes, and divides the openings up to the face of the wastegate (if you're into that type of nit-pickiness).

Downpipe is something that I assembled, mild steel parts, with wastegate tie-in including flex section. Starts out as 4", then has an expansion to 5". Also have a 5" section that attaches to that and extends back to 2nd gen transmission mount exhaust hanger (with hanger). Had been previously coated with cerakote.

These parts will get you set up to go on a 2nd gen, using OEM exhaust manifold position. If you have an automatic you will have to relocate/modify your transmission dipstick tube to get it out of the way of the wastegate setup - I will throw in mine for free if you have an auto and want the setup!
